Background

IL-31 Protein activates STAT3 and potentially STAT1 and STAT5 through the IL31 heterodimeric receptor, which consists of IL31RA and OSMR. It has been suggested to play a role in skin immunity and enhances the survival of myeloid progenitor cells in vitro. IL-31 Protein also induces the expression of RETNLA and serum amyloid A protein in macrophages. These diverse functions highlight the significance of IL-31 Protein in various biological processes and suggest its potential implications in immune regulation and cell survival.
